Bernie Blast

The Yankees, down 5-3 in the 8th, score two in each of the last two innings to take a 7-5 victory against the Nationals. Bernie Williams provided the game winning hit when he homered to right-center in the top of the 9th inning, his sixth of the year. The Yankees struggled to score tonight, but when you allow another team to get on base 20 times in a game, they're going to collect a few runs.
